Keys for older or rare BMW models.
BMW has come a very long way in the field of car key technology. From the simple metal keys to the smart remote unlocking and Comfort Access features of today's. A lot of newer models come with the BMW Display Key touchscreen. Whatever technology you use, you'll still need to be able to program your BMW fob.
The first step is to know the type of key you own. The earliest system was EWS, which was present on all vehicles up to 1995, and on some models with push-to-start. The next was CAS, which was present from 2002 until 2013 or 2014. The most recent system is FEM/BDC, that is present on all BMWs. If you are not sure which type of key you are using, look up your owner's manual.

Many of the latest BMW models have key fobs that have a built-in transponder. These transponders send a distinct signal to the immobilizer system of your car, which prevents unauthorised starting. Keys with transponders can be more expensive than standard keys, however they provide greater security. Always check your owner's guide to determine what kind of key your vehicle requires.
Certain key fobs are smart keys that can be used to lock, unlock and start the car without the requirement of a physical key. They use a wireless signal to communicate with the car's systems and can be shared between up to five users. This feature doesn't protect your key from being copied.
